Catalog note / 解説
"Narihira Toka Zu" (Picture of Narihira Traveling to the East ). From the series, "Kokka" (The Flowers of the Nation) published in Meiji era, which introduced old masterpieces of Japanese art. The albums included some of the most skillfully and elaborately produced woodblock prints to date. Here, the famed poet, Narihira is on horse traveling to Edo. The original painting was in the collection of the IWASAKI family who was the founder of Mitsubishi Conglomerate in Meiji era.
